Fluke's 190 Series II 500 MHz ScopeMeter Test Tool has a 5 GS/s sample rate
Fluke's 190 Series II 500 MHz ScopeMeter Test Tool achieves a 500 MHz at 5 GS/s real time sample rate. The two-channel 190-502 model is the latest in the 190 Series II with bandwidth from 60, 100, 200, — and now 500 — MHz.
The 5 GS/s — or 200 picoseconds — sample rate of the Fluke 190-502 is designed to provide greater accuracy and clarity of shape and amplitude of unknown waveform phenomena like transients, induced noise and ringing or reflections.
The rugged 190 Series II ScopeMeter test tools include functions like ScopeRecord, TrendPlot, advanced triggering and automatic measurements functions. The 190 Series II safety rating according to IEC 61010 standard is 1000 V CAT III 600 V CAT IV making it possible to safely measure from mV to 1000 V.
